Philadelphia's Best Cheesesteak: Campo's



Campo's on Market in Old City made the top of my list for the best cheesesteak I ate in Philadelphia. Granted, I didn't make it to South Philly or Tony Luke's. The Campo family opened a little corner grocery in 1947. The next generation took over in 1975. There is still a mom and pop homey feel.

The steak is chopped, and the sandwiches come with onions and peppers. The bread is from Sarcone's Bakery. It was definitely the best cheesesteak I ate in Philly and the only place I returned to more than once.







Little peppers stuffed with prosciutto and cheese were addictive.
